2,000 join Keretapi Sarong at Ipoh station for Malaysia Day
About 2,000 people filled the Keretapi Tanah Melayu station in Ipoh today for Keretapi Sarong, a Malaysia Day celebration in traditional and retro attire. The fifth edition featured cultural performances, traditional games and visits to venues around Ipoh Old Town.

Ipoh gets RM12.5m tourism boost, coffee festival to be annual
Ipoh is set to receive RM12.5 million for tourism and Kinta Riverfront upgrades, announced by Housing and Local Government Minister Nga Kor Ming at the inaugural Ipoh Coffee Festival 2026 at Riverfront @ Old Town. The festival, which drew thousands over four days, will become an annual event alongside the Ipoh Food Festival, with a white coffee master competition planned for next year.

McDonald's holds Piknik Famili Terbesar at Pengkalan Chepa and Pantai Batu Buruk
McDonald's Malaysia held its Piknik Famili Terbesar @ Mekdi at two East Coast locations, Pengkalan Chepa in Kelantan and Pantai Batu Buruk in Terengganu, on 5 September. The event offered free meals, traditional games, a children's fashion show and the Mekdi mascot, and introduced the new Ayam Goreng McD Rasa Ori menu.
